Best Financial Markets Analysis ArticleLarry D. Spears writes: A mere 15 years ago, selecting the right exchange-traded fund (ETF) was no big challenge. That's because the first ETF wasn't introduced until 1993, and the second didn't follow until 1995. Since then, however, the growth rate among these versatile investment vehicles has been exponential - so fast, in fact, that the monitoring firm Morningstar now tracks the performance of 854 ETFs, with new funds being added almost weekly.

Best Financial Markets Analysis ArticlePeople with insulin-dependent diabetes (all of type-1 and about 27 percent of type-2 diabetics) lack the necessary amount of insulin in their bloodstreams. This can and often does lead to irreversible damage to their hearts, blood vessels, eyes, kidneys, skin, feet and hearing. In individuals taking insulin injections to reduce blood sugar levels severe hypoglycemia can cause organ failure and death.

Best Financial Markets Analysis ArticleAlmost 200,000 people heading to the California gold fields crossed through what is now Nevada via the California Trail. Many camped close to the confluence of the Humboldt River and Maggie Creek in northeastern Nevada. None of them had any idea they were just a very short distance away from one of the most prolific gold deposits in the world.
